Let these bold and joyful socks remind you to bring Christ to others. St. Christopher was a tall and powerful man who wandered the world in search of adventure. During his travels, he met a hermit who lived next to a dangerous river. Teaching Christopher about Jesus, the hermit suggested he help travelers cross the treacherous waters as a way to use his gifts. Christopher carried a child across the river and was nearly crushed by his weight. The boy then revealed that he was the Christ, so heavy because he bore the weight of the world. The name Christopher means "Christ bearer." Honor him as the Patron Saint of Travelers and give a unique Catholic gift. Collect them all!
